Tezlink/Kernel: Add functions in account_storage to handle manager and account initialization
Previous MR
Next MR
What
Add functions in Tezlink account_storage to handle manager fields and account initialization.
Why
Manager fields are needed for operation as this is the field where we'll retrieve the public key for a tz account.
The exist function will be useful for the validity of a Tezlink operation, to verify if an account exist (we check as
this is the field that represent activity on an account).
An init function was also introduced to init all necessary fields of an account
Checklist
-
Document the interface of any function added or modified (see the coding guidelines) -
Document any change to the user interface, including configuration parameters (see node configuration) -
Provide automatic testing (see the testing guide). -
For new features and bug fixes, add an item in the appropriate changelog ( docs/protocols/alpha.rstfor the protocol and the environment,CHANGES.rstat the root of the repository for everything else). -
Select suitable reviewers using the Reviewersfield below. -
Select as Assigneethe next person who should take action on that MR
Edited by Arnaud Bihan